Debt-to-Income Ratio: A Key Consideration
Lenders assess your debt-to-income ratio to determine how much of your monthly income goes toward debt payments. A lower ratio suggests that you have a good balance between debt and income, which is attractive to lenders. Aim to keep your debt-to-income ratio below 36%, with no more than 28% of that debt going toward housing expenses2.
